The FIBA Intercontinental Cup is an international basketball competition organised by FIBA, the sport's global governing body. The champions of the competition are considered the de jure champions of the world, as representatives from all confederation can participate in the competition.

The current competitions is played by the winners of each year's Basketball Africa League, Basketball Champions League, Basketball Champions League Americas, NBA G League and FIBA Asia Champions Cup.

Confederation records

Only including modern era (2013–present) participations.

FIBA Africa

Year Club Method of qualification Performance Ref(s)
2022 Egypt Zamalek (1/1) Winners of the 2021 BAL season Fourth Place
2023 Tunisia US Monastir (1/1) Winners of the 2022 BAL season TBD

FIBA Americas

Year Club Method of qualification Performance Ref(s)
2013 Brazil Pinheiros (1/1) Winners of the 2013 FIBA Americas League Runners-up
2014 Brazil Flamengo (1/4) Winners of the 2014 FIBA Americas League Champions
2015 Brazil Bauru (1/1) Winners of the 2015 FIBA Americas League Runners-up
2016 Venezuela Guaros de Lara (1/2) Winners of the 2016 FIBA Americas League Champions
2017 Venezuela Guaros de Lara (2/2) Winners of the 2017 FIBA Americas League Runners-up
2019 Brazil Flamengo (2/4) Hosts Runners-up
2020 Argentina San Lorenzo (1/1) Winners of the 2019 FIBA Americas League Runners-up
2021 Argentina Quimsa (1/1) Winners of the 2019–20 BCL Americas Runners-up
2022 Brazil Flamengo (3/4) Winners of the 2021 BCL Americas Champions
2023 Brazil Flamengo (4/4) Winners of the 2021–22 BCL Americas TBD

FIBA Europe

Year Club Method of qualification Performance Ref(s)
2013 Greece Olympiacos (1/1) Winners of the 2012–13 Euroleague Champions
2014 Israel Maccabi Tel Aviv (1/1) Winners of the 2013–14 Euroleague Runners-up
2015 Spain Real Madrid (?) Winners of the 2014–15 Euroleague Champions
2016 Germany Skyliners Frankfurt (1/1) Winners of the 2015–16 FIBA Europe Cup Runners-up
2017 Spain 1939 Canarias (1/4) Winners of the 2016–17 Basketball Champions League Champions
2019 Greece AEK (1/1) Winners of the 2017–18 Basketball Champions League Champions
2020 Spain 1939 Canarias (2/4) Hosts Champions
Italy Virtus Bologna (?) Winners of the 2018–19 Basketball Champions League Runners-up
2021 Spain San Pablo Burgos (1/2) Winners of the 2019–20 Basketball Champions League Champions
2022 Spain San Pablo Burgos (2/2) Winners of the 2020–21 Basketball Champions League Runners-up
2023 Spain 1939 Canarias (4/4) Winners of the 2021–22 Basketball Champions League TBD

Northern America (NBA)

Year Club Method of qualification Performance Ref(s)
2019 United States Austin Spurs (1/1) Winners of the 2018–19 NBA G League season Fourth Place
2020 United States Rio Grande Valley Vipers (1/3) Winners of the 2019–20 NBA G League season Fourth Place
2022 United States Lakeland Magic (1/1) Winners of the 2021–22 NBA G League season Third Place
2023 United States Rio Grande Valley Vipers (2/2) Winners of the 2022–23 NBA G League season TBD
